I have a Traktor Kontrol S2 MK3, which I use with a macbook pro, running Traktor pro v3 software.

For the last week, when I slide my left tempo fader up on the controller, the fader representation on the software doesn't budge - i can't slow down the track I'm playing from the controller. It works as normal when I slide it down to speed up. The right side tempo fader works perfectly (slide up/down).

I can move it up on the Traktor pro software if needed by moving it up with my mouse, and if I use sync on the left side of the controller to correspond with the master track playing on the right side, it automatically moves up if the right track is slow - but again, moving the slider up manually on the controller just wont' work.

I've tried completely reinstalling the software but no luck, also tried re-running the setup wizard. It still behaves in the same way. I tried to reinstall the device firmware but as I'm on the latest version it won't update.

Has anyone experienced this? If so did you manage to fix it? Any help or suggestions would be greatly welcome.

    When you slide it up, does traktor get midi signals? There is a symbol in the top middle that should light up.

    Do you have any custom mappings active?

    If no to both, you can try to get dirt out of the fader with compressed air, and relube it with something like DeoxIT F5 CAIG Faderlube.
